The Millennium Gate Museum in Midtown Atlanta, Georgia is a great place for photographers to visit due to its unique and visually striking architecture and its rich cultural and historical exhibits. The museum, which is located in a replica of the Arc de Triomphe in Paris, is dedicated to preserving and promoting the history and culture of the state of Georgia.
With a range of immersive and interactive exhibits, the museum offers a variety of opportunities for photographers to capture creative and interesting shots. Whether you’re interested in documenting the museum’s exhibits or using the space as a backdrop for portraits or other types of photography, the Millennium Gate Museum is sure to provide ample inspiration and cultural significance.
